The GEARWRENCH 243 Pc. 12 Pt. Mechanics Tool Set in 3 Drawer Storage Box (80972) packs a full lineup of sockets and combination wrenches into one box. You get both SAE and metric sizes, so you’re ready for whatever vehicle or project lands in front of you. The chrome finish holds up well and resists rust, and the 90-tooth ratchet gear turns smoothly with very little arm swing. It works in tight corners and on stubborn fasteners without a lot of fuss.

The 90-tooth ratchet gear is the highlight here. It only needs a 4-degree swing to catch the next tooth, which means you can turn fasteners in cramped spots where a longer swing won’t fit. Fewer movements per turn gets the job done faster, and users keep mentioning how much easier it makes tight-quarters work.

Versatile Combination Wrenches
The set includes 12-point full polish long pattern combination wrenches. The 12-point opening grabs the fastener from more angles, so the wrench slips less. The long handle gives you extra leverage to break loose tight bolts and nuts without straining.

Enhanced Efficiency
The short swing arc on the ratchet means you can keep the wrench on the fastener instead of pulling it off to reposition. That protects the bolt head and anything around it from accidental dings. Complex jobs go smoother when you’re not constantly resetting the tool.
